Output 57727008e068a3f5d51391e07dd0d6f045d8b18f402ca171cda1c2f51e9acbbd:0

value
24298000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a0224e86abb1d97bf0392c076e9df498e26400 OP_EQUAL
address
3KXPXFr9pgwGj8L2VGqhjAYfb15iywDNkU
transaction
57727008e068a3f5d51391e07dd0d6f045d8b18f402ca171cda1c2f51e9acbbd
confirmations
414344
spent
true